Transaction 0212ab08ae92e90f736fa84dae7734d609b25410f9b50d7cf7987a88d25b2f79

block
129c964515e26495766882c20133cc207fa870b24c90e6691e2f7ac7c948b1d5

1 Input

201 Outputs